Birch Tree Pruning in Aiken, SC

Birch tree pruning services involve carefully trimming and shaping birch trees to promote healthy growth, improve appearance, and prevent potential hazards. This service covers a variety of projects, including removing dead or diseased branches, reducing the size of overgrown trees, and maintaining the overall structure of the tree. Homeowners typically request this service to enhance their landscape’s aesthetic, ensure safety around their property, or support the long-term health of their trees.

Before requesting birch tree pruning, property owners should consider the specific needs of their trees, such as whether they are experiencing issues like broken limbs or disease, and the desired outcome for the tree’s shape and size. It’s also helpful to understand the best timing for pruning to avoid unnecessary stress on the tree and to ensure proper growth. Clear information about the tree’s location, size, and condition can assist in planning the most effective pruning approach.

Project Types

Common Birch Tree Pruning Jobs

Birch Tree Pruning - removes dead or damaged branches to promote tree health.

Shape Trimming - refines the tree’s form for aesthetic appeal and proper growth.

Thinning - reduces density to improve airflow and reduce wind resistance.

Height Reduction - lowers the tree’s height to prevent interference with structures or power lines.

Safety Pruning - eliminates branches that pose a risk to property or people.

Maintenance Pruning - encourages healthy growth through regular, targeted trimming.

FAQ

Birch Tree Pruning Questions

What is the purpose of birch tree pruning? Pruning helps maintain tree health, encourages proper growth, and improves overall appearance.

When is the best time to prune a birch tree? The ideal time is during late winter or early spring before new growth begins.

How does pruning affect the safety of a property? Proper pruning reduces the risk of falling branches and keeps trees stable during storms.

What types of pruning are commonly performed on birch trees? Crown thinning, crown raising, and deadwood removal are typical pruning methods used.
